Interventions
BEHAVIORAL

PrEP Master Adherence Intervention

"The PrEP Master Adherence Intervention consists of 4 face to face individual education sessions and a series of telephone contacts to identify barriers and facilitators to optimal PrEP adherence over a six-month period. Each PrEP Master education session includes a review of an individualized plan to reduce risk, review of information about PrEP, and different discussion points. Key messages include:~1. Importance of daily adherence;~2. Three week delay for full effectiveness describing PrEP like taking the birth control pill;~3. Condom use for other sexually transmitted infection (STI) prevention;~4. Pregnancy prevention plans;~5. Plans for follow up calls~6. Referral to other treatment services if necessary"
